Garen Cole Sallee was born Sept. 10, 1981. He departed his earthly life and joined his heavenly father on Jan. 1, 2010. Visitation will be at 12:30 p.m. Wednesday, Jan. 6, at Hope Lutheran Church, 6308 Quivira Road, Shawnee, Kan. Funeral services will follow the visitation at 1:30 p.m. In lieu of...
